[0019] exist figure 1 In the valve train operating device according to the first embodiment, a rocker-arm-shaped cam follower of a valve train of an internal combustion engine and a hydraulic support for supporting the cam follower are shown, which are not further shown. The hydraulic support has a cup-shaped housing 1 in which a cylindrical piston is guided. The piston protrudes from the housing 1 with a support head 2 on which a rocker-shaped cam follower is supported in an end region so as to be pivotable. A storage space 3 for pressure medium for the hydraulic compensation of the valve play is formed inside the piston.

[0020] The piston is designed in two parts with an upper piston part and a lower piston part, wherein the upper piston part has a support head 2 . The piston upper part and the piston lower part are arranged coaxially one after the other in the housing 1 . Abstract

A valve train actuating device for an internal combustion engine including a lever-type cam follower and a hydraulic support element for supporting the cam follower is provided. The hydraulic support element includes at least one piston guided in a housing (1), the piston having at least one reservoir (3) for pressure medium for a hydraulic valve lash adjustment. The piston cooperates on a supporting head (2) projecting out of the housing (1) with a supporting region (4) of the cam follower, and a pressure medium inlet is configured on the supporting head (2) and on the supporting region (4) for supplying pressure medium to the reservoir (3).

Description

technical field [0001] The invention relates to a valve train operating device for an internal combustion engine according to the type defined in detail in the preamble of patent claim 1 . Background technique [0002] The hydraulic supports for the cam followers in the valve train are usually supplied with pressurized oil through channels by the oil pump of the internal combustion engine. DE 10 2008 038 792 A1 shows a hydraulic support for a controllable rocker arm of a valve train of an internal combustion engine. There, the pressure piston is guided in a bore of a cup-shaped housing on which a rocker arm is supported in the end region on a head protruding from the housing. Two accumulators for pressure medium for the hydraulic compensation of the valve play are formed inside the pressure piston.
